When considering the right vehicle scissor lift for your operations, the choice between electric and hydraulic models can significantly impact performance and efficiency. Electric scissor lifts are known for their quieter operation and reduced emissions, making them ideal for indoor use. They require less maintenance over time, with fewer moving parts, which can help to lower overall operating costs. However, it's crucial to note that their battery life can limit operational time, particularly in high-demand scenarios.
On the other hand, hydraulic scissor lifts offer impressive lifting capacity and speed, enabling faster operation, especially in outdoor environments. They are typically more robust and can handle heavy loads with ease, which is advantageous for construction sites or large-scale maintenance work. Yet, they may demand more frequent upkeep to ensure the hydraulic systems remain functional and leak-free.
**Tips:** When selecting a scissor lift, assess the typical weight loads and height requirements of your operations to choose the most appropriate model. Consider trialing both electric and hydraulic options to gauge their performance in your specific environment before making a final decision. Always prioritize safety features like emergency stop buttons and guard rails to protect your workforce during operations.
